Issue Description
Styler does not accept CSS value string types enclosed in double quotes. In particular, it crashes if the string contains semi-colons. This means full number-format strings cannot be passed to Styler for exporting to Excel. Excel number format is of the form: <positive>;<negative>;<zero>;<text>. The semi-colon dividers here will conflict with CSS semi-colon dividers unless they can be properly encapsulated in a string.
The problem is rooted in the naive string split in maybe_convert_css_to_tuples and CSSResolver. A possible fix using the TextFileReader parser is shown in the Expected Behavior section.

if you are considering a solution a similar issue arises for LaTeX captions, which use a colon. The solution was in _parse_latex_table_styles
Notes-----Thereplacementof"§"with":"istoavoidtheCSSproblemwhere":"hasstructuralsignificanceandcannotbeusedinLaTeXlabels, butisoftenrequiredbythem.
"""
for style in table_styles[::-1]: # in reverse for most recently applied style
if style["selector"] == selector:
return str(style["props"][0][1]).replace("§", ":")
return None
Since CSS is a specific language a need to parse semi-colons and colons differently is not required, imo.
The number-format css attribute is a pandas construct to hack the to_excel output. Since it is a pandas construct we can direct users how to interact with it so that it works. See the PR and comment if you object.
